I have been out on I-80 thru Wyoming and of course all thru Colorado lately.

The thing that concerns me is consistency. There is none of it. Some campgrounds are open, most are not. The primitive USFS campgrounds seem to be the most available right now. Open range camping is probably best where you can find it. It is still available.

Anything reservable is now gone! You have to count on walk in, non reservable sites now. The thing that rattles me more than anything is this strange vibe going thru everything right now. Everybody wants to get out. There is a lot of freaky behavior coming out now. And as has been pointed out here already, getting harder and harder to listen to.

We do have some reservations for this month, but they are very close to home and can be changed quickly. With the new cases on the rise again (57,236 Yesterday), this is not going away any time soon.

I did get to raft 13 miles of class IV white water this week with my kid. There were walk in camping sites still available river side.

We called a Wisconsin County Park this morning to make camping reservations
The park manager told us not to make reservations because

1) The park has only been about 1/2 full since they opened , so plenty of campsites
2) Due to the increase in Covid cases the Park Board is considering reclosing the park to camping and the situation may change on very short notice .
3) If we did make reservations and they were cancelled by the Park Board they would refund our camping fee but not our reservation fee .

We were only planning on a 3 day trip but even that becomes difficult when everything is constantly up in the air
